Quart in ounces

1 US fluid ounce = 0.03125 US quarts

32 US fluid ouces = 1.0 US quartsn

Are there four ounces in a quart?

128/4=32 Explanation = there are 4 quarts in a gallon. there are 128 ounces in a gallon. so you would divide 128 by 4 and get 32. There are 32 ounces in a US quart and there are 40 ounces in an imperial quart.
